Meaning of warranty in English. a written promise from a company to repair or replace a product that develops a fault within a particular period of time, or to do a piece of work again if it is not satisfactory: The warranty covers the car mechanically for a year, with unlimited mileage.
Scope of warranty coverage: This should define the services and materials covered by the warranty. Warranty duration: State the start and end dates. Exclusions and limitations: Lists conditions not covered, such as wear and tear, accidental damage, misuse, and natural disasters.
Warranties provide a guarantee about the condition of goods and services purchased, providing an assurance that they are as advertised. They are generally only good for a specified period. When that period ends, the issuing entity is no longer obligated to repair or replace a product previously covered.
Standard Warranty Statement This product is warranted against defects in materials and workmanship for a period of one year from the date of original purchase. This warranty does not cover damage caused by misuse, accident, or unauthorized modifications.

A Warranty Guide is a document that outlines the terms, conditions, and coverage details for products, typically detailing the warranty period, what is covered, and any limitations.
Manufacturers, sellers, or distributors of products that come with a warranty are required to file a Warranty Guide to inform consumers about their rights and obligations.
To fill out a Warranty Guide, one must enter the product information, warranty terms, coverage details, and any specific conditions or exclusions. Ensure all legal requirements are met according to applicable laws.
The purpose of a Warranty Guide is to provide consumers with clear and concise information about the warranty offered, helping them understand their rights, what is covered, and how to make a claim.
The Warranty Guide must report information such as product description, warranty coverage details, limitations and exclusions, claim procedures, and the duration of the warranty.
